Now i can say back to the desk. Investigators are looking into how another intruder got into a restricted area on the property of Mineta San Jose International airport. Janine de la vega is live at mineta where after vane is an investigation is underway. Reporter good morning. Well, congressman Eric Swalwell is concerned, hes on the Homeland Security subcommittee for transportation security. Hes been closely monitoring this airport because of the past four breaches. This makes number five in less than a year. This time it happened on the back side of the airport across from the stadium. A woman apparently scaled the fence. All morning long weve seen security patrols driving back and forth. They are on heightened alert. A woman managed to walk on the tarmac across the runway before she was spotted by a u. P. S. Employee on the other side. Officers found her near the southwest cargo area where u. P. S. Has its operations. Police say she was combative and refused to give her identity but they say she is young. Congressman swalwell is calling on increased security, specifically technology, saying this airport and others are not doing enough to secure perimeters. Companies have technology that will alert airport officials the moment the perimeter is preached. They can distinguish distinguish human a human an animal. A pilot program, i believe should be taken plate across the Country Place across the country. Reporter police was arrested. They are still trying to figure out why she wanted to get on the tarmac and if she wanted to cause harm. They are already in review mode because of the past four breaches. They will be looking at the surveillance video. Weve reached out to an airport spokeswoman. Were hoping to get comment from them later on this morning. Tori . A graduate student, its reported, allegedly put a poison into the Water Bottles of his lab mates last fall and reportedly two students became ill. The unnamed student has pleaded not guilty by reason of insanity to felony charges. A spokesperson calls it a sad and heartbreaking situation and says the affected students are receiving support from the university. 7 06. Kaiser permanente looking for people today to take part in a major study on autism spectrum disorders. Researchers will collect Genetic Information from what they are calling trios. Two biological parents and a child diagnosed with autism. Kaiser is hoping to gather information from 5,000 member families. Researchers say the goal create a resource for effective autism treatments. A wind whipped wildfire that prompted dozens of evacuations in Southern California began as a controlled burn. The fire is burning in San Bernardino county near victorville. The control burn was set yesterday. Winds blew it out of control. Fire frills say the fire burned so fast that about 25 homes had to be evacuated dash. About 70 acres burned and the fire is now 30 contained. The San Francisco Housing Market is so hot the median selling price for a home is nearly 1 million. Real estate firm redfin says the medium price is february was 979,000. Thats up 16 from a year ago. San jose is fast approaching the market with 942,000 and in oakland, the medium price is up but its still less than 600,000. The real estate Listing Service says only 15 of homes in San Francisco are within reach of middleclass buyers. I heard that San Francisco could hit the mark by may. By may. Well talk about that and also whats in store for the weekend. Welcome back. The state of african saw now just arkansas one signature away from creating a religious freedom law. Brian flores here in the studio with this lastminute push to get the governor, brian, to veto it. Yeah, several bay area companies, even local governments have expressed disapproval of this bill being considered in indiana and just passed in arkansas yesterday. It still has to be signed by the governor of arkansas. All indications point it will be signed. Known as the house bill 1228, it would prevent state and local governments on infringing on someones beliefs without a compelling interest. This goes back to bill clinton signing the religious freedom restoration act. Supporters of the blil say all it does bill say all it does is show support but opponents say it will open up flood gates to allow discrimination. The issue is not im not for having the government or any entity force me as a Business Owner to do any particular item. This bill will permit people to be treated like strangers. Walmart, which is based in arkansas, came out in opposition to the legislation. The companys ceo asked the governor to veto the bill saying it undermines the spirit of inclusion and does not preflecket the values we uphold in the state. Libby schaaf is the latest in a series of california politicians and Business Leaders to ban city paid travel to indiana because of the religious freedom restoration act passed there. Ed lee also panned City Employees from traveling to indiana on city business. Many prayer firms have come out against this. San franciscos board of supervisors is set to vote on a proposed ordinance next week that would ban tour bus drivers from also narrating their own tours. The ordinance would require companies to a have a separate narrater on the bus in addition to the driver. Its part of the citys vision zeer dro plan which aims to eliminate traffic related deaths within the next nine years. The goal is to cut back on distracted driving. Its important that tour Bus Companies that are profiting by showing off our beautiful city commit to hiring two staff members, one to narrate and one to drive. While some Companies Already have separate narraters others cant afford to and plan to fight the ordinance they say would put them out of business. People attending sales forces huge annual tech conference in San Francisco can now skip a hotel and rent a room on the high seas. Its called the dreamboat. Sales force chartered the luxly cruise ship as a lodging option for attendees of the dream force conference. People can stay on the ship for four nights. The rooms look like some of these pictures here and costs between 250 and 850 a night with 135,000 registered attendees for dream force. Its often difficult to find a hotel in the city.
